Withnail & I (1987)

Description: Two struggling actors take a holiday in the Lake District, where their friendship is tested by various misadventures, providing a darkly comedic look at friendship.

Fact: The film has become a cult classic, with many of its lines becoming part of British vernacular.

The Full Monty (1997)

Description: Six unemployed steelworkers from Sheffield form a male striptease act to make some money, showcasing the strength of male friendship in tough times.

Fact: The film won an Academy Award for Best Original Musical or Comedy Score.

The History Boys (2006)

Description: A group of bright but unconventional students navigate their final year at school, with their friendships and ambitions shaping their futures.

Fact: Adapted from Alan Bennett's play, the film features a strong ensemble cast, including future stars like Dominic Cooper and James Corden.

The World's End (2013)

Description: A group of old friends reunite to complete a pub crawl they failed 23 years ago, only to discover an alien invasion. It's a mix of friendship, nostalgia, and sci-fi comedy.

Fact: This is the third film in Edgar Wright's "Three Flavours Cornetto" trilogy, following "Shaun of the Dead" and "Hot Fuzz."

The Intouchables (2011)

Description: An unlikely friendship forms between a wealthy quadriplegic and his ex-convict caregiver, showcasing how friendship can transcend social and physical barriers.

Fact: This French film was a massive international success, becoming one of the highest-grossing non-English films ever.
